Calcolo Intervallo Tra Date

Calcolatore Intervallo tra Date

Intervallo Totale: 0 giorni
Giorni: 0
Settimane: 0
Mesi: 0
Anni: 0

Guida Completa al Calcolo dell’Intervallo tra Date

Il calcolo dell’intervallo tra due date è un’operazione fondamentale in molti ambiti, dalla pianificazione di progetti alla gestione finanziaria, dalla logistica alla programmazione di eventi. Questa guida approfondita ti fornirà tutte le informazioni necessarie per comprendere e applicare correttamente il calcolo degli intervalli temporali.

Perché è Importante Calcolare gli Intervalli tra Date

  • Pianificazione Progetti: Determinare la durata di un progetto o di una fase specifica
  • Gestione Finanziaria: Calcolare interessi, ammortamenti o scadenze di pagamenti
  • Logistica: Pianificare consegne, spedizioni o tempi di transito
  • Risorse Umane: Gestire periodi di ferie, permessi o contratti di lavoro
  • Analisi Storica: Studiare intervalli temporali tra eventi storici o economici

Metodi di Calcolo degli Intervalli

Esistono diversi approcci per calcolare l’intervallo tra due date, ognuno con le proprie caratteristiche e casi d’uso specifici:

  1. Metodo Inclusivo: Include sia la data di inizio che quella di fine nel calcolo.
    • Esempio: Dal 1 gennaio al 3 gennaio = 3 giorni
    • Utilizzo: Calcolo di periodi di noleggio, soggiorni in hotel
  2. Metodo Esclusivo: Esclude una o entrambe le date estreme.
    • Esempio: Dal 1 gennaio al 3 gennaio = 1 giorno (escludendo entrambe)
    • Utilizzo: Calcolo di interessi bancari, scadenze contrattuali
  3. Metodo “Giorni di Calendario”: Conta tutti i giorni nel periodo, indipendentemente dai giorni lavorativi.
    • Utilizzo: Pianificazione generale, calcolo di scadenze legali
  4. Metodo “Giorni Lavorativi”: Esclude sabati, domeniche e festivi.
    • Utilizzo: Calcolo di tempi di consegna, scadenze amministrative

Fattori che Influenzano il Calcolo

Quando si calcola un intervallo tra date, è importante considerare diversi fattori che possono influenzare il risultato:

Fattore Descrizione Impatto sul Calcolo
Anni Bisestili Anni con 366 giorni (febbraio ha 29 giorni) Può aggiungere 1 giorno al calcolo se febbraio è incluso
Fusi Orari Differenze di orario tra località Può causare discrepanze di 1 giorno in casi limite
Ore del Giorno Orario specifico (non solo data) Può influenzare il conteggio se si considerano ore precise
Festività Locali Giorni festivi specifici per paese/regione Importante per calcoli di giorni lavorativi
Convenzioni di Arrotondamento Metodi per arrotondare mesi/anni parziali Può variare il risultato finale

Applicazioni Pratiche del Calcolo di Intervalli

1. Settore Finanziario

Nel mondo della finanza, il calcolo preciso degli intervalli temporali è cruciale per:

  • Calcolo degli interessi su prestiti e investimenti (interesse semplice vs composto)
  • Determinazione delle scadenze per opzioni e derivati finanziari
  • Pianificazione degli ammortamenti di mutui e leasing
  • Valutazione della performance di investimenti (TWR, MWR)

Secondo la U.S. Securities and Exchange Commission, la corretta misurazione degli intervalli temporali è fondamentale per la trasparenza nei report finanziari e per prevenire pratiche di “window dressing”.

2. Gestione Progetti

In project management, gli intervalli tra date sono utilizzati per:

  • Creazione di diagrammi di Gantt
  • Calcolo del critical path
  • Monitoraggio delle milestone
  • Gestione delle dipendenze tra attività
Confronto tra Metodologie di Pianificazione
Metodologia Precisione Intervalli Flessibilità Complessità
Waterfall Fissa (pianificazione iniziale) Bassa Media
Agile/Scrum Iterativa (sprint di 2-4 settimane) Alta Alta
Critical Path Precisa (basata su dipendenze) Media Alta
Kanban Continuous flow Molto alta Bassa

3. Settore Legale

In ambito legale, il calcolo degli intervalli è essenziale per:

  • Determinazione dei termini di prescrizione
  • Calcolo dei tempi processuali
  • Gestione delle scadenze contrattuali
  • Pianificazione delle udienze

Secondo lo studio “Temporal Aspects in Law” dell’Harvard Law School, il 37% delle controversie legali derivano da interpretazioni errate dei termini temporali nei contratti.

Errori Comuni nel Calcolo degli Intervalli

Anche operatori esperti possono commettere errori nel calcolo degli intervalli tra date. Ecco i più frequenti:

  1. Dimenticare gli anni bisestili:

    Non considerare che febbraio può avere 29 giorni può portare a errori di 1 giorno in calcoli che attraversano febbraio in un anno bisestile.

  2. Confondere giorni lavorativi con giorni di calendario:

    Utilizzare il metodo sbagliato può portare a differenze anche del 40% nel risultato (5 giorni lavorativi vs 7 giorni di calendario).

  3. Ignorare i fusi orari:

    In sistemi internazionali, la differenza di fuso orario può far sembrare che un evento sia avvenuto in giorni diversi.

  4. Arrotondamenti errati:

    Arrotondare 1.99 mesi a 1 mese invece che a 2 può portare a errori significativi in progetti lunghi.

  5. Non considerare l’ora del giorno:

    Se si considerano solo le date senza l’ora, si possono perdere informazioni cruciali (es. 23:59 del 1 gennaio vs 00:01 del 2 gennaio).

Strumenti e Tecnologie per il Calcolo degli Intervalli

Esistono numerosi strumenti, sia manuali che automatici, per calcolare gli intervalli tra date:

  • Fogli di calcolo (Excel, Google Sheets):

    Funzioni come DATEDIF(), DAYS(), NETWORKDAYS() permettono calcoli avanzati. Tuttavia, richiedono attenzione nella configurazione per evitare errori.

  • Linguaggi di programmazione:

    Tutte le principali lingue (JavaScript, Python, Java, etc.) hanno librerie per la gestione delle date. Ad esempio, in JavaScript si usa l’oggetto Date, mentre in Python la libreria datetime.

  • Software specializzati:

    Strumenti come Microsoft Project, Jira, Trello offrono funzionalità avanzate per la gestione degli intervalli temporali nei progetti.

  • API e servizi web:

    Servizi come Google Calendar API o librerie come Moment.js (ora Luxon) offrono funzionalità avanzate per il calcolo degli intervalli.

Best Practices per un Calcolo Accurato

Per garantire la massima accuratezza nel calcolo degli intervalli tra date, segui queste best practices:

  1. Definisci chiaramente le convenzioni:

    Stabilisci se il calcolo è inclusivo o esclusivo delle date estreme e comunicalo chiaramente a tutti gli stakeholder.

  2. Documenta il metodo utilizzato:

    Specifica se stai usando giorni di calendario o lavorativi, e quali festività stai considerando.

  3. Verifica gli anni bisestili:

    Assicurati che il tuo sistema riconosca correttamente gli anni bisestili (divisibili per 4, ma non per 100 a meno che non siano divisibili per 400).

  4. Considera i fusi orari:

    Se lavori con date in diversi fusi orari, standardizza su UTC o specifica chiaramente il fuso orario di riferimento.

  5. Testa con casi limite:

    Verifica il tuo calcolo con date che includono:

    • Passaggio tra mesi/anni
    • Anni bisestili
    • Periodi che includono festività
    • Intervalli di un solo giorno
  6. Usa librerie affidabili:

    Per sviluppatori, è consigliabile utilizzare librerie testate e mantenute (come Luxon per JavaScript o dateutil per Python) invece di implementare logiche custom.

  7. Considera l’internazionalizzazione:

    Se il tuo sistema sarà usato in diversi paesi, assicurati che gestisca correttamente:

    • Formati di data locali
    • Festività nazionali
    • Calendari non gregoriani (es. islamico, ebraico)

Esempi Pratici di Calcolo

Esempio 1: Calcolo di un Mutuo

Supponiamo di voler calcolare l’intervallo tra il 15 marzo 2023 e il 15 marzo 2028 per un mutuo quinquennale:

  • Giorni totali: 1826 (inclusivo) o 1825 (esclusivo)
  • Anni: 5
  • Mesi: 60
  • Settimane: ~260.86

Esempio 2: Pianificazione di un Progetto

Calcolo della durata di un progetto dal 10 gennaio 2023 al 30 giugno 2023 (escludendo festività italiane):

  • Giorni di calendario: 171
  • Giorni lavorativi: ~122 (escludendo sabati, domeniche e 5 festività)
  • Settimane: ~24.43
  • Mesi: ~5.57

Esempio 3: Calcolo di Interessi Bancari

Calcolo degli interessi su un deposito dal 1 luglio 2023 al 31 dicembre 2023 (metodo 30/360):

  • Giorni: 180 (metodo 30/360 standard bancario)
  • Giorni effettivi: 184
  • Differenza: 4 giorni (2.17%)

Considerazioni Legali e Fiscali

Il calcolo degli intervalli temporali ha importanti implicazioni legali e fiscali:

  • Prescrizione:

    In Italia, i termini di prescrizione (ad esempio 10 anni per i crediti) iniziano a decorrere da date specifiche. Un errore nel calcolo può comportare la perdita del diritto.

  • Scadenze Contrattuali:

    Molti contratti prevedono clausole che scattano dopo specifici intervalli temporali (es. opzioni di rinnovo, penali per ritardi).

  • Adempimenti Fiscali:

    Le scadenze per la presentazione di dichiarazioni (es. 730, IVA) sono calcolate con precisione e i ritardi comportano sanzioni.

  • Garanzie Legali:

    La garanzia legale di conformità (2 anni per i beni di consumo) decorre dalla data di consegna del bene.

Secondo il Codice Civile Italiano (Art. 2964), “la prescrizione si compie quando l’ultimo giorno del termine coincide con un giorno festivo, ma gli effetti si producono dal primo giorno successivo non festivo”.

Tendenze Future nel Calcolo degli Intervalli

L’evoluzione tecnologica sta portando nuove sfide e opportunità nel calcolo degli intervalli temporali:

  • Intelligenza Artificiale:

    Sistemi di AI possono analizzare pattern temporali complessi per prevedere durate di progetti o identificare ritardi potenziali.

  • Blockchain:

    Le timestamp immutabili della blockchain stanno rivoluzionando la certificazione di date e intervalli in ambito legale e finanziario.

  • Internet delle Cose (IoT):

    Dispositivi connessi possono registrare con precisione microsecondi temporali per tracciamenti logistici ultra-precisi.

  • Calendari Intelligenti:

    Sistemi che integrano automaticamente festività locali, fusi orari e preferenze personali per calcoli contestualizzati.

  • Analisi Predittiva:

    Algoritmi che analizzano storici di intervalli per ottimizzare pianificazioni future.

Conclusione

Il calcolo dell’intervallo tra date è una competenza trasversale che trova applicazione in quasi ogni ambito professionale e personale. Una comprensione approfondita dei diversi metodi di calcolo, dei fattori che possono influenzare il risultato e delle best practices da seguire può fare la differenza tra una pianificazione accurata e costosi errori.

Che tu stia gestendo un progetto complesso, calcolando interessi finanziari o semplicemente pianificando le tue vacanze, ricordati sempre di:

  1. Scegliere il metodo di calcolo più appropriato al contesto
  2. Considerare tutti i fattori rilevanti (bisestili, festività, fusi orari)
  3. Documentare chiaramente le tue assunzioni
  4. Verificare sempre i risultati con casi limite
  5. Utilizzare strumenti affidabili e testati

Con queste conoscenze, sarai in grado di affrontare qualsiasi sfida legata al calcolo degli intervalli temporali con sicurezza e precisione.

Leave a Reply

Your email address will not be published. Required fields are marked *